Details have been released for DC Comics – The New 52: Five Years Later Omnibus from Amazon, collecting all of DC's comics in September in one volume, much as they did with Villains Month, Zero Month and the original New 52 Launch month.

DC Comics are making a change to the way they make their themed variant covers will be open to order, with no minimum order of another item required Which means retailers can order as many of them as they like, and they will be more available to customers to buy and preorder…

Run by Del Howison and his wife Sue, Dark Del is a mecca for fans of horror from books, comics, novelties, movies, soundtracks and even fragrances It is an amazing place to go just about any day.
